相关疑难解决方法(0)

如何在时钟上绘制点

自Unix时代开始以来,我有几秒钟的时间.我想用24小时制作它们.到目前为止我的努力是

from __future__ import division
import matplotlib.pyplot as plt
import numpy as np
angles = 2*np.pi*np.random.randint(0,864000,100)/86400
ax = plt.subplot(111, polar=True)
ax.scatter(angles, np.ones(100)*1)
plt.show()
Run Code Online (Sandbox Code Playgroud)

这给出了以下内容

尝试在时钟上绘图

但是,这并不是我想要的.

  • 如何将圆点放在圆周上而不是放在内部(或至少将它们从中心向外移动)?
  • 如何将标签从角度更改为时间?
  • 我怎么能摆脱0.2, 0.4, ...
  • 基本上,我怎样才能让它看起来更像是时钟上标记的点?

python matplotlib

5
推荐指数
1
解决办法
1592
查看次数

标签 统计

matplotlib ×1

python ×1